Application of high-content pebbles in concrete
The invention provides an application of high-content pebbles in concrete. The concrete comprises raw materials in parts by weight as follows: 80-110 parts of cement, 40-70 parts of coal powder ash, 85-95 parts of pebbles, 40-50 parts of fine sand and 12-16 parts of a foaming agent, wherein a ratio of water, the cement, the coal powder ash, the pebbles, the fine sand and the foaming agent is kept to be 0.5-0.65, the cement, the sand, ground fine mineral powder, the coal powder ash and a water reducing agent are put in a large mandatory type stirrer and stirred for 30 min, the high-content pebbles are added for stirring, and the stirring time is not shorter than 120 min. According to the application of the high-content pebbles in the concrete, a large quantity of sediments in a river channel is cleaned, the river channel becomes clear and smooth, large quantities of manpower and material resources for flood control are reduced, unnegligible contribution to the flood control work is provided, and great social and economic benefits can be produced.
